Normally I would agree with the treatment of the "Unique " trait on most vehicles. The one that doesn't agree with me is the treatment of the Bishop . Over 140 of these oddities were built and some survived into the Italian campaign . So for me as long as the engagement was El  Alamein and beyond , I would not disagree about a second model being employed to form in effect a small battery to match the treatment of the Priests. Anyway for the Germans I wouldn't object if guys wanted to double up on say the Dianas ,Stugs or Panzer 2 Bisons.. I don't think any of these are game changers and finally additional Marders perhaps could be allowed if one was fielding the 15th Panzer Division in 1942 . The only vehicle category I wouldn't be keen to increase is that of the Tiger. For obvious reasons too many of these would spoil the game at this period .

Army list are a guideline, not holy words. Feel free to mod them as you see fit (agreed beforehand with your opponent).
On Tigers: Try fielding a platoon of 3 Tigers and you will lose most of the games. A lot of points invested in things that SURELY would be breakdowned & minestriked. Or subject to constant pinning by puny area shots from stuarts.
